How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Hulen Springs Meadow?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Hulen Springs Meadow Studio Apartments | $1,068 | $868 | $1,358 |
Hulen Springs Meadow 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,318 | $390 | $2,393 |
Hulen Springs Meadow 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,658 | $972 | $2,794 |
Hulen Springs Meadow 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,158 | $1,299 | $2,999 |
Hulen Springs Meadow 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,447 | $1,673 | $3,150 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Hulen Springs Meadow Apartments with Hardwood Floors
What is the Cheapest Hardwood Floors apartment in Hulen Springs Meadow?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Hulen Springs Meadow with Hardwood Floors is at Tides on Westcreek listed at $845.
How much is the average rent for Hulen Springs Meadow Apartments with Hardwood Floors?
The average rent for a Apartment in Hulen Springs Meadow with Hardwood Floors is $1,625.
What is the largest Hulen Springs Meadow Apartment for rent with Hardwood Floors?
Today's Apartment with Hardwood Floors and the most square footage in Hulen Springs Meadow is a 1,822 square feet unit starting from $2,575 at Tavolo Park Townhomes.
What is the average size for Hulen Springs Meadow Apartments for rent with Hardwood Floors?
The average size for a rental with Hardwood Floors in Hulen Springs Meadow is currently at 718 sq ft.
